Collecting Sugarcane





Collecting sugarcane is an essential action in the cane sugar handling chain, as it straight affects the quality and return of the end product. Appropriate timing and strategies are necessary during this phase to guarantee optimal sugar web content and minimize losses. Usually, sugarcane is collected when it reaches maturation, normally 12 to 18 months after planting, identified by a high sucrose focus.

The harvesting procedure can be conducted manually or mechanically. Hand-operated harvesting includes skilled laborers making use of machetes to reduce the cane, making certain marginal damage to the stalks. This technique allows discerning harvesting, allowing workers to select just one of the most fully grown stalks while leaving younger ones to develop even more. On the other hand, mechanical harvesting makes use of customized devices to cut and collect the walking cane successfully. Although this method enhances productivity and minimizes labor expenses, it might bring about greater levels of impurities in the collected material.


Post-harvest, the sugarcane should be refined quickly to avoid sucrose degradation. Ideally, gathered cane ought to be transported to processing centers within 24 hr to maintain sugar quality. Consequently, efficient logistical planning is crucial to preserve the integrity of the harvested plant throughout the supply chain.

Filtration Techniques



The purification strategies used in walking stick sugar handling are crucial for changing the raw juice into a high-quality sugar product. These methods largely aim to get rid of pollutants, such as dirt, plant materials, and inorganic substances, which can detrimentally affect the end product's flavor and shade.


This process entails adding lime and warmth to the raw juice, which promotes the coagulation of impurities. Additionally, the use of phosphoric acid can enhance the explanation process by more binding contaminations.


One more substantial method is carbonatation, where co2 is presented to the cleared up juice. This response creates calcium carbonate, which records staying contaminations and advertises their elimination.


Additionally, triggered carbon treatment might be related to adsorb any kind of continuing to be colorants and natural contaminations, making certain a much more refined her response product. The combination of these techniques effectively prepares the sugar juice for succeeding steps in the refining procedure, establishing the stage for the manufacturing of high-quality walking cane sugar.
